Brentford // April 2 - 9

After three months of teachings and working with the surrounding area in London, our sports and media DTS team headed off on a 2 month journey to bring God's joy, hope and love to nations. Our first stop was in Brentford, a little town outside of London, England. We arrived at Brentford Free Church and were greeted by the pastor. During our time in Brentford we took part in different Easter services, helping with worship, giving testimonies and performing dramas. Our team also went out into town evangelizing in various ways; face painting, playing football in the park, leading a service at an elderly folks home, and talking to people on the street.

One of the highlights of the week was on Easter Sunday evening. Our team hosted a night with the teens from the church to watch the Passion of the Christ film. The movie was so impactful on each and every person and the worship and prayer that followed was indescribable- totally Holy Spirit led.
